COVID-19 Wedding – Persimmon Country Club

Hosting a COVID-19 wedding is a current reality of the summer weddings in 2020. Alanna and Alek had a wonderful wedding at the Persimmon Country Club practicing proper social distancing and mask wearing safety to ensure all their guests and vendors felt comfortable attending their wedding during COVID-19. The guest count was under 25 and they hosted the wedding and reception outdoors on the beautiful patio overlooking the epic Persimmon Golf Course with views of Mt. Hood and the hills beyond. All the guests wore masks and many of them had ones that coordinated with their outfits, making it a great way to express their style while still looking out for the safety of their loved ones.

At the ceremony each guest had their own seat reserved with customized name-cards with each couple or family group sitting together, yet properly spaced from the other pairings of guests for safety. During the reception cocktail tables were spaced throughout the patio and the catering staff served a variety of plated appetizers to each guest. The guests continued to wear their masks and be social at a distance through out the reception.

It was a beautiful sunny day and I loved spending time with the happy couple and their wonderful family and friends. Because of COVID-19 wedding restrictions in Oregon, it was a very unique event. However the celebratory atmosphere was not hindered by the restrictions due to the pandemic. It was a perfect intimate wedding celebrating their love and commitment to each other.
